Nothing Phone (4b) confirmed to use Snapdragon chipset ahead of July 7th launch

Highlights

Nothing has confirmed another key detail about its upcoming Nothing Phone (4b) ahead of its global and India debut on July 7th. The company has announced that the smartphone will be powered by a Qualcomm Snapdragon processor, although the exact chipset will only be revealed during the launch event. The announcement comes just days after multiple leaks and a Geekbench listing suggested the handset could use Qualcomm’s Snapdragon 6 Gen 4 SoC.

Leaked and confirmed specifications

Nothing has only confirmed the presence of a Snapdragon processor so far. However, a recent Geekbench listing points to the Snapdragon 6 Gen 4 chipset, paired with 8GB RAM and Android 16-based Nothing OS. Separately, tipster Yogesh Brar claims the Phone (4b) will feature a 6.7-inch AMOLED display with a 120Hz refresh rate, a 5,400mAh battery, and a dual rear camera setup led by a 50MP primary sensor. The phone is also expected to be available in 8GB + 128GB and 8GB + 256GB storage variants.
